Steps to find the percentage of a number

Method 1: Using Proportions

Let's find 3% of 76.6 using proportion.

3% is 3 out of 100.

\[ \frac{ 3 }{100} \]

Write the proportion to find x out of 76.6.

\[ \frac{ 3 }{100} = \frac{x}{ 76.6 } \]

Cross-multiply: 3 × 76.6 = 100x

\[ 3 \cdot 76.6 = 100x \]

Solve for x: (3 × 76.6) ÷ 100 = x

\[ \frac{ 229.8 }{100} = x \]

Hence, 3% of 76.6 is 2.298.

Method 2: Keyword-Based

Use keywords: "of" means multiply.

Convert 3% to decimal: 0.03

\[ x = 76.6 \cdot 0.03 \]

Multiply 76.6 × 0.03 = 2.298

So, 3% of 76.6 is 2.298.

Method 3: Formula-Based

Use the formula: percent × whole = part

Convert 3% to decimal: 0.03

\[ \text{Percentage} \cdot \text{Whole} = \text{Part} \]

76.6 × 0.03 = 2.298

Thus, 3% of 76.6 is 2.298.
